1919 Ad Boutwell Milne Varnum Dark Barre Granite Graves - ORIGINAL WW3 MOV1 There is a noticeable creaseThis is an original 1919 black and white print ad for the Boutwell, Milne & Varnum Company, located in Montpelier, Vermont. This ad features their Dark Barre Granite, the Rock of Ages, which is used in monuments and gravestones. CONDITION This 92+ year old Item is rated Very Fine +++. Light aging in margins. No creases.
